school busDear Parents:
You will soon receive bus route descriptions for our school. Please look over the routes and find the stop nearest your house and go to that stop when school begins. The buses serving A. B. Combs will be color coded and labeled again this year. You will need to give the drivers at least a ten minute leeway on the scheduled arrival times. For example, if your child is scheduled to be picked up at 7:40 am, the bus may be as early as 7:30 am or as late as 7:50 am. This is due to the uncertainty of traffic. Hopefully, after the drivers do the routes a few times, they will be able to give you a more exact pick-up time.

If you have questions or concerns about your child's stop, you may contact Denise Jobe, Transportation Supervisor, located at Broughton High School at 856-7821. Your child's safety is a top priority for us. We ask you to join us in our efforts to ensure a safe and pleasant ride on our school buses by reviewing the following rules with your child.
Students should:

1. Be on time. The bus cannot wait for you.
2. Wait at the bus stop without running around or playing.
3. Enter and exit the bus without pushing or crowding.
4. Show respect for the driver at all times and accept his/her authority.
5. Talk in a reasonable tone of voice to the people near you.
6. Find a seat and stay in it - keep all body parts inside the bus.
7. Refrain from eating or drinking on the bus.
8. Avoid littering the bus. Never throw anything on the bus.
9. Keep your hands and feet to yourself.

Bus drivers have a tremendous responsibility for operating the bus and maintaining good behavior of the students in their care. Since students' inappropriate behavior can distract the driver, we are asking that drivers let Mrs. Summers or me know immediately if there is a problem. Continued or serious misconduct may lead to the following:

First offense - Warning letter to parent
Second offense - Suspension from the bus for one to five days.
Third offense - Suspension from the bus for ten days.

Thank you for helping us get off to a great start with school bus safety. Please feel free to call Denise Jobe at 856-7821 or me at 233-4300, if you have questions about transportation. See you soon.
